Hawkins County Sheriff’s Office unit involved in Monday crash
The Tennessee Highway Patrol said that a crash in Bulls Gap on Monday evening took place after a Hawkins County Sheriff’s Office unit crossed the center line of Highway 11E and hit a car waiting to turn. The crash was reported on December 29 around 5:20 p.m. at the intersection of the Andrew Johnson Highway and N Main Street in Bulls Gap. The report said a Hawkins County Sheriff’s Office Dodge Challenger was traveling southbound on Andrew Johnson Highway. The second vehicle was stationary on Highway 11E waiting to make a right turn. That’s when the cruiser crossed the line and made impact. The second vehicle was then pushed into a third vehicle due to the the impact. No injuries were reported and no charges have been filed.
